Hi All,

We are running MQ Version 6 on windows 2003( We have extended support from IBM for this ).

Messages are put through a channel on queue Manager A, from there it goes to an alias queue on Queue Manager B.
However the messages are stuck in the transmit queue of queue manager A. The cluster channels between two queue Managers are up and running.
The listeners are up and running.
There are no uncommitted msgs on the transmission queue. This is the error in logs of server A
============================================
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------
16/04/2014 11:53:11 - Process(5240.1 User(MUSR_MQADMIN) Program(amqrmppa.exe)
AMQ9002: Channel 'TO_REPBRI_PW12_SEC' is starting.

EXPLANATION:
Channel 'TO_REPBRI_PW12_SEC' is starting.
ACTION:
None.
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------
16/04/2014 11:53:32 - Process(5240.1 User(MUSR_MQADMIN) Program(amqrmppa.exe)
AMQ9209: Connection to host 'SERVER B)' closed.

EXPLANATION:
An error occurred receiving data from 'SERVER B' over TCP/IP.
The connection to the remote host has unexpectedly terminated.
ACTION:
Tell the systems administrator.
----- amqccita.c : 3094 -------------------------------------------------------
16/04/2014 11:53:32 - Process(5240.1 User(MUSR_MQADMIN) Program(amqrmppa.exe)
AMQ9999: Channel program ended abnormally.

EXPLANATION:
Channel program 'TO_REPBRI_PW12_SEC' ended abnormally.
ACTION:
Look at previous error messages for channel program 'TO_REPBRI_PW12_SEC' in the
error files to determine the cause of the failure.
=============================================

Please could you suggest what needs to be done for messages to flow out of transmission queue.

Well this prompts a few questions in my mind:


  • Are the time clocks really over 4 minutes out ? That seems like a lot
  • Has this channel ever worked ? Or is it a problem that has just started happening?
  • Is the channel going over anything unusual - like IPT for example
  • Both ends seem to be complaining that the connection was closed on them - this is often indicative of a firewall (or something) getting in the way. It is unusual for it to happen just seconds after the connection is made though
